Thanks Rich ... I was really hoping for this since we're replacing a Microsoft HIS server with ICC attachment of our Telnet clients. Since IBM sort of insistent on two OSA cards we figured why not. No use in incurring Telnet overhead directly in the VSE system if you have an alternative. Since each OSA has two physical ports we still have a two QDIO defined ports available for other IP releated functions. -- Kevin Corkery Independent Consultant Voorhees, New Jersey -------------- Original message ---------------------- From: Rich Smrcina <rsmrcina@wi.rr.com> > Hardcoded IPs are *not* required. Only the LUName, if you need to map a > device number to a specific terminal session (eg: to make sure that a > session can ALWAYS connect to a certain device number, for a certain > purpose like a z/VM console or something). > > For VSE consoles I use dial devices under z/VM. So that I (as the > operator) can DIAL VSE 01F to be the VSE console. > > Kevin Corkery wrote: > > Gang ... > > > > The ICC configuration Redbook indicates that the client's IP address must be > know, i.e. hard IP address assignments. I can understand that this may be true > for something that's going to be defined and used as a console. Is this true > for general TN3270 clients that will attach as regular VTAM locally defined > terminals? The example configuration I received from the business partner would > seem not to require the IP for anything other than consoles. It would seem way > too infexible to require this type of connection for general purpose terminals. > Can anyone confirm from experience that my general purpose 3270 clients can have > DHCP assigned IPs?
